Basement Sump Pump Service in Manchester, NH
Basement sump pump services focus on the installation, maintenance, and repair of sump pumps designed to protect homes from flooding and water damage. These systems are typically installed in the lowest part of a basement or crawl space to automatically remove excess water that accumulates due to heavy rainfall, melting snow, or high water tables. Projects may include upgrading existing pumps, addressing frequent malfunctions, or installing new units to ensure reliable operation during storms or heavy rain events. Property owners often want to understand the capacity and type of sump pump suitable for their home, as well as how to ensure it functions properly over time.
Before requesting sump pump services, homeowners should consider the specific needs of their property, such as basement size, water table levels, and drainage conditions. It’s common to inquire about the signs of a failing sump pump, like unusual noises or frequent cycling, and whether additional measures such as backup systems are recommended for added protection. Understanding the maintenance requirements and lifespan of the sump pump can help property owners make informed decisions about ongoing care and upgrades to safeguard their homes against water intrusion.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ump and how does it work?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ement to remove excess water,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
When should a sump pump be replaced or upgraded? Replacement is recommended when a sump pump shows signs of frequent failure, loud operation, or inability to keep up with water flow.
What are common issues that affect sump pump performance? Common problems include power outages, clogged discharge lines, and mechanical failures, which can hinder proper water removal.
How can property owners maintain their sump pump? Regular inspections, clearing debris from the inlet and discharge lines, and testing the device ensure proper operation and longevity.
